Abstract
The synthesis of two novel π-extended oligomers, incorporating naphtho[1,2-b]thiophene-4-carboxylate 2-octyldodecyl esters as end-capping moieties, and two different
conjugated core fragments, has been achieved through a cascade sequence of sustainable
organic reactions. Benzo[c][1,2,5]thiadiazole and 2-octyldodecyl benzo[1,2-b:6,5-b′]dithiophene-4-carboxylate have been used, respectively, as electron-poor and electro-rich
π-conjugated cores. In the latter case, a sequence of nine aromatic rings in a fully
conjugated structure is achieved with a high yielding, sustainable cascade approach.
The optoelectronic properties of both oligomers are reported.
